Xiangguang Chen is a scholar working on Physiology, Pollution and Cell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Xiangguang Chen has authored 19 papers receiving a total of 478 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Physiology, 8 papers in Pollution and 7 papers in Cell Biology. Recurrent topics in Xiangguang Chen’s work include Reproductive biology and impacts on aquatic species (9 papers), Zebrafish Biomedical Research Applications (7 papers) and Pesticide and Herbicide Environmental Studies (5 papers). Xiangguang Chen is often cited by papers focused on Reproductive biology and impacts on aquatic species (9 papers), Zebrafish Biomedical Research Applications (7 papers) and Pesticide and Herbicide Environmental Studies (5 papers). Xiangguang Chen collaborates with scholars based in China and United States. Xiangguang Chen's co-authors include Miaomiao Teng, Chengju Wang, Jie Zhang, Le Qian, Manman Duan, Chen Wang, Feng Zhao, Chengju Wang, Wentian Zhao and Suzhen Qi and has published in prestigious journals such as Environmental Science & Technology, The Science of The Total Environment and Journal of Agricultural and Food Chemistry.
